I think the emotion response it was trying to elicit was the same as in dark cloud 2, where in the death of a major character happened in Chapters 3, 5, and 7. The difference being in that Dark cloud 2 built up these characters the best they could before offing them. No matter how many times I play DC2, Master Crest's death will always manage to bring a tear to my eyes because you get to see the impact it has on the surrounding characters Lyn is crushed, and it shows. It also effects you, because you spent hours doing everything you can; Fighting bosses, time traveling, Fighting Gaspard and those goddamned Evil Flames. Hell, you have to sit through Monica's unskippable Spheda lecture. And then, as soon as you're ready to save the day and bring the legendary sage to glory, it's all ripped away from you in his final act of heroism. The way you describe it, Rogue Galaxy does the exact same thing, but crams it down within a couple of minutes.
